Etymology

edit

Borrowed from Italian Reale.

Proper noun

edit

Reale (plural Reales)

  1. A surname from Italian.

Statistics

edit
  • According to the 2010 United States Census, Reale is the 10631st most common surname in the United States, belonging to 3012 individuals. Reale is most common among White (93.96%) individuals.
